Abstract

The invention discloses a Milky Way halo craft and a preparation method thereof. The Milky Way halo craft comprises a black base frame, white star patterns dotted on the base frame, multiple layers of silica gel positioned on the base frame, Milky Way patterns which are coated on the silica gel layers and are made of noctilucent powder consisting of acrylic pigment and a strontium aluminate long-afterglow luminescent material, and a topmost silica gel layer. The preparation method comprises the following steps: firstly, dotting the white star patterns on the black base frame; secondly, with the silica gel as a filling agent, coating the noctilucent powder consisting of the acrylic pigment and the strontium aluminate long-afterglow luminescent material according to the designed Milky Way patterns upwardly from the base frame dotted with the white star patterns by sequentially alternating a silica gel layer, and a noctilucent powder layer consisting of the acrylic pigment and the strontium aluminate long-afterglow luminescent material and coated in the silica gel layer in a dispersed way, till the Milky Way patterns are formed; and finally, covering the topmost protective silica gel to obtain the Milky Way halo craft.

Description

technical field [0001] The invention relates to a Milky Way light rhyme handicraft and a preparation method thereof. Background technique [0002] Long afterglow material is a kind of green fluorescent material. It is mainly used for concealed and emergency lighting. It can also be used as a doping material to be mixed with ceramics, glass and plastics to obtain corresponding luminescent materials, which can emit light in the dark. The products can play the role of facilitating life and embellishing life. The low luminance and short afterglow time of traditional long afterglow materials restrict the development of long afterglow materials. [0003] Therefore, how to improve the luminous intensity and increase the afterglow time has become an important topic for long afterglow material handicrafts to enter the market.
